Furthermore, according to an article published by Michigan State University, in November 2025, Ultrasound has become a key tool for managing reproduction in small ruminants, helping farmers accurately detect pregnancies, determine gestational age, and estimate litter size. This allows them to use resources more efficiently and maintain healthier flocks or herds. Recent improvements in B-mode ultrasound units-like battery-powered portable designs, headset displays, water-assisted probes, and wireless streaming to tablets or smartphones-have made field scanning faster, easier, and more flexible. At the same time, newer devices provide better image quality even in affordable models, enabling earlier and more precise fetal checks on-site. These advances in portability, imaging, and cost-effectiveness are encouraging more widespread use of ultrasound in small ruminant reproduction, supporting better herd management.
The product pricing analysis for the U.S. animal ultrasound industry considers the cost structures associated with major solution categories, including console/cart-based systems, portable and handheld devices, transducers/probes, and consumables. Ultrasound prices differ widely depending on features, imaging quality, and portability. Lower-cost handheld devices are primarily used for on-farm pregnancy checks, while more expensive console systems in clinics offer advanced functions, such as Doppler and 3D/4D imaging. On top of the initial purchase, ongoing costs such as ultrasound gel, probe covers, cloud storage subscriptions, and yearly service contracts add to the total cost of ownership and create steady revenue streams for manufacturers and veterinary service providers.
